BuyangHuanwu Decoction attenuates cerebral vasospasm caused by subarachnoid hemorrhage in rats via PI3K/AKT/eNOS axis

Abstract

The ancient Chinese remedy BuyangHuanwu Decoction (BHD) is used to treat qi deficit and blood stasis conditions. This work investigated the effect of BHD on cerebral vasospasm (CVS) caused by subarachnoid hemorrhage (SAH). Rats were randomly assigned into four groups: control group, SAH group, SAH + BHD [13 g/(kg day)] group, and SAH + BHD [26 g/(kg day)] group. The Garcia neurological scoring scale was used to assess neurological dysfunction. Hematoxylin and eosin stains were used to determine the extent of vasospasm by measuring the diameter of the basilar artery. Western blot was used to measure the concentrations of phosphoinositide 3-kinase (PI3K), AKT, and phospho-AKT expression levels. RT-PCR was used to determine PI3K and AKT RNA expressions. Immunohistochemistry and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ay were used to measure levels of endothelial nitric oxide synthase (eNOS) and nitric oxide (NO), respectively, in cerebrospinal fluid. BHD treatment ameliorated CVS and mitigated neurological dysfunction after SAH. Furthermore, the findings suggest that NO concentration was increased through the activation of classical PI3K/AKT signaling and the eNOS pathway. Thus, BHD showed multifaceted roles in preventing damage via decreasing vasospasm and improving neurological impairments caused by CVS after SAH.
